                    Blade was startled by his words, pressing her earphone. "Phoenix, wait for the right moment. It's more important to protect the child."
Phoenix had already changed into the lab assistant's clothes, whispering, "Got it."
She swiped her card into the lab and stood behind everyone, watching Laura in the mirrored glass.
Carol didn't notice her and commanded, "Wake her up."
Laura suddenly felt a tingling pain spread throughout her body, and she abruptly opened her eyes.
What greeted her was a strange world.
She didn't know what room this was, it was just cluttered with trophies and photos on the table.
Laura felt like there was something on her head, but she couldn't remove it no matter how hard she tried.
She had to give up.
Puzzled, she stood up and walked around the room. "Is anyone there?"
On the other side of the glass, there was a large screen on the console.
It was the VR world that Laura could see.
Phoenix manipulated the UAV to project this VR world for Blade and the others to see.
Laura seemed unaware that this was fake, picking up the photos placed on the table.
In the photo, Lilian wore a cheerleader uniform, standing together with Winnie.
Her mother had a radiant smile, while Winnie gently held her arm. The two sisters looked very close and even somewhat similar.
Laura was a little happy. "Mom?"
Carol took the microphone handed to her, cleared her throat, and spoke, "Lala."
Laura's heart trembled, and she turned to look behind her.
Lilian, who was dressed in a school uniform, stood at the door of the room with a smile. "I'm here."
Laura widened her eyes in surprise, looking at Lilian.
It was sunny, and Lilian's ponytail was tied high, her smile warmer than the sunlight coming in from outside.
This was the mother Laura had never seen before.
Very young, beautiful, and radiant, she seemed to be in her teens.
Laura couldn't help but stare in astonishment.
Carol walked into the lab, carrying equipment on her, and crouched down, arms wide open. "Won't you give me a hug?"
Laura's breath hitched, and she threw herself at her with open arms, hugging her tightly.
Before Laura could say anything, tears were already streaming down her face. "Mom, did the car crash hurt you? Are you still in pain?"
Carol, with a fake smile, hugged the unsuspecting Laura. "The pain has long gone."
Laura was very happy, touching her face. "You look so young, so beautiful. Are you feeling better now? Don't you want to cry? Aren't you sad anymore?"
Carol's smile stiffened slightly as she nodded. "Not sad anymore."
Laura became increasingly joyful. "You've gotten over it, right? You mean you won't care if Uncle, Dad, and Carol like you anymore, right?"
Carol was speechless. 'Why am I the one being addressed so impolitely?'
Carol shook her head. "I don't care anymore, I don't care about anyone, I only care about you."
Laura widened her eyes, tears streaming down her face without warning.
Her mother had never been this gentle to her before.
She was afraid this was a dream. "Really? Is this a dream?"
Carol nodded and said, "Yes, it's real, so to repay me, will you give me a little encouragement?"
Laura nodded without hesitation, joyfully saying, "Mom, I can earn money now. You don't have to ask that weird mister for money anymore. I can use my money to buy you a house, a big one. I'll protect you, Mom. Whatever you want, I can buy it for you. I've saved up a lot of money, I'll give it all to you, okay?"
Carol raised her eyebrows and asked, "Really?"
Laura nodded hurriedly. "Yes."
Carol smiled gently. "But I don't want anything from you. I just want you to do me a favor."
Laura said without hesitation, "Go ahead."
Carol stood up, looking down at her. "You know, I have always hoped that my mom could see me, but I'm not smart enough, I'm stupid. But you're different, you're smart. I would be very happy if you're willing to do an experiment with her."
Laura was taken aback. "Do an experiment with Grandma Carol?"
Carol nodded, but hesitated. "Don't you want to agree?"
Outside the glass window, the staff in the lab smirked slightly.
Tiara felt satisfied. "The thing children can't live without the most is their mother. She will definitely agree."
Phoenix found it difficult to breathe, unable to resist speaking, "But is it okay to use a child's love for her deceased mother like this?
Everyone was taken aback and turned to look at her.
Phoenix suddenly tensed up. 'Oh no! I forgot I sneaked in. How can I speak?'
But no one realized she wasn't one of them. Glancing at her work card, someone sneered, "There are always sacrifices for scientific progress. Besides, this child hasn't lost anything, at least she gets to see her mom, right?"
Phoenix was speechless.
Another man mocked, "I heard this child's mom was a kept woman before she died, chased by the first wife and hit by a car. The child is not an illegitimate one, so I made her mother appear at her purest moment. She should thank me for that."
Phoenix looked at the screen in astonishment.
Lilian was wearing the uniform of Laura's school.
She looked like a high school student.
Phoenix had heard rumors.
Lilian was not valued in the family and had a straightforward personality, but she was also an exceptional beauty.
Joshua had even said that Lilian should also become Tyler's disciple as she was very suitable for it.
But later, it seemed that Lilian had done a lot of things, and Joshua gradually stopped mentioning this youngest sister, even beginning to feel disgusted towards her.
Joshua behind the screen couldn't bear it any longer as well.
He looked at the high school-aged Lilian as if everything from the past came flooding back to his mind.
Even if Lilian died in disgrace, she couldn't be talked about as a kept woman.
He couldn't let her appear in front of Laura like this.
This was all fake!
Unable to bear it any longer, Joshua finally got up and rushed out, followed closely by Dexter.
Laura, still unaware that her mother was fake, furrowed her brow, feeling a bit troubled. "Mom, Grandma Carol isn't a good person. Please don't think about her anymore, okay? She's the one who harmed you."
She urgently grabbed Carol's hand. "You know, Uncle and the others, and even you, have been manipulated. Carol's like the villain in a TV drama, stirring up trouble between you two. In fact, Uncle and the others were sent to the lab. Grandma Carol lied to you."
Carol's expression darkened, pushing her away. "That's not true. My mom wouldn't lie to me."
Laura, caught off guard, sat on the ground, shocked.
Carol glared at her coldly. "Laura, don't forget your origin."
Laura's face turned pale.
Carol grabbed her hair and lifted her. "I made a mistake, and you have to bear the consequences with me because your blood is tainted."
Laura, caught off guard, struggled in pain. "Mom, I know, I haven't forgotten."
